We provide the geometrical meaning of the N = 4 superconformal index. With this interpretation, the N = 4 superconformal index can be realized as the partition function on a Scerk-Schwarz deformed background. We apply the localization method in TQFT to compute the deformed partition function since the deformed action can be written as a delta(epsilon)-exact form. The critical points of the deformed action turn out to be the space of flat connections which are, in fact, zero modes of the gauge field. The one-loop evaluation over the space of flat connections reduces to the matrix integral by which the N = 4 superconformal index is expressed.
